- private SchemaContext schemaContext;
-
- @Before
- public void setUp() {
- schemaContext = TestModel.createTestContext();
- assertNotNull("Schema context must not be null.", schemaContext);
- }
-
- private static YangInstanceIdentifier instanceIdentifierFromString(String s) {
- return PathUtils.toYangInstanceIdentifier(s);
- }
-
- @Test
- public void testNormalizeNodeAttributesToProtoBuffNode() {
- final NormalizedNode<?, ?> documentOne = TestModel.createTestContainer();
- String id =
- "/(urn:opendaylight:params:xml:ns:yang:controller:md:sal:dom:store:test?revision=2014-03-13)test"
- + "/(urn:opendaylight:params:xml:ns:yang:controller:md:sal:dom:store:test?revision=2014-03-13)outer-list"
- + "/(urn:opendaylight:params:xml:ns:yang:controller:md:sal:dom:store:test?revision=2014-03-13)outer-list[{(urn:opendaylight:params:xml:ns:yang:controller:md:sal:dom:store:test?revision=2014-03-13)id=2}]"
- + "/(urn:opendaylight:params:xml:ns:yang:controller:md:sal:dom:store:test?revision=2014-03-13)id";
-
- NormalizedNodeGetter normalizedNodeGetter = new NormalizedNodeGetter(id);
- new NormalizedNodeNavigator(normalizedNodeGetter).navigate(
- PathUtils.toString(YangInstanceIdentifier.EMPTY), documentOne);